diff --git a/platypush/entities/sensors.py b/platypush/entities/sensors.py index 3cad591656..a47c91c854 100644 --- a/platypush/entities/sensors.py +++ b/platypush/entities/sensors.py @@ -20,6 +20,9 @@ logger = logging.getLogger(__name__) class Sensor(Device): __abstract__ = True + def __init__(self, *args, is_read_only=True, **kwargs): + super().__init__(*args, is_read_only=is_read_only, **kwargs) + if 'raw_sensor' not in Base.metadata: